Hyundai Palisade 2.5 Turbo HEV Calligraphy (2026) vs Lexus LX 700h Premier (2025): which should you buy?

The Hyundai Palisade 2.5 Turbo HEV Calligraphy (₱3.98 million) and the Lexus LX 700h Premier (₱11.23 million) cater to very different buyer segments. The Palisade offers a large‑crossover SUV with a 2.5‑litre turbo‑hybrid inline‑4 delivering 334 PS and 422 Nm, paired with a 6‑speed automatic and AWD. Its unibody construction, 5‑door layout and flexible 2+2+3 seating make it practical for families who need everyday versatility and a modest luxury feel, all while staying under ₱4 million and enjoying a 5‑year/200 000 km warranty. The Lexus, by contrast, is a premium body‑on‑frame SUV with a larger 3.4‑litre turbo‑hybrid inline‑4 producing 409 PS and 650 Nm, mated to a 10‑speed automatic and 4WD. It commands a seven‑seat layout, a more robust off‑road capable chassis, and a higher‑end finish, but at more than double the price and a shorter 3‑year/100 000 km warranty. For Filipino buyers seeking a spacious, family‑oriented crossover with strong hybrid performance at a realistic price, the Palisade is the sensible choice. Those who prioritize maximum power, premium branding, and rugged capability and are willing to pay a premium should look at the LX 700h.

Frequently asked questions

Which model is cheaper?

The Hyundai Palisade 2.5 Turbo HEV Calligraphy is priced at ₱3,980,000, while the Lexus LX 700h Premier costs ₱11,228,000, making the Palisade significantly cheaper.

Which SUV has more power?

The Lexus LX 700h Premier produces 409 PS and 650 Nm of torque, surpassing the Palisade’s 334 PS and 422 Nm.

What are the key differences in drivetrain and construction?

The Palisade uses an AWD system with unibody construction, whereas the LX 700h employs a 4WD system on a body‑on‑frame chassis, giving the Lexus a more rugged platform.

Which vehicle is more practical for daily family use?

The Palisade’s 2+2+3 seating, lower price, longer warranty (5 years/200 000 km) and unibody design make it more practical for everyday family commuting compared to the larger, premium‑focused LX 700h.
